diff options
Diffstat (limited to 'src/Coefficients_2_1.F90')
-rw-r--r-- | src/Coefficients_2_1.F90 | 5 |
1 files changed, 3 insertions, 2 deletions
diff --git a/src/Coefficients_2_1.F90 b/src/Coefficients_2_1.F90 index 35b261b..99f21c7 100644 --- a/src/Coefficients_2_1.F90 +++ b/src/Coefficients_2_1.F90 @@ -31,7 +31,7 @@ subroutine set_coeff_2_1 ( nsize, loc_order, bb, gsize, imin, imax, dd ) dd = zero imin = 0 - imax = 0 + imax = -1 if ( bb(1) == 0 ) then il = 1 + gsize @@ -51,6 +51,7 @@ subroutine set_coeff_2_1 ( nsize, loc_order, bb, gsize, imin, imax, dd ) imin(nsize) = nsize-1; imax(nsize) = nsize ir = nsize - 2 end if +!$omp parallel do do i = il, ir dd(i-1,i) = -a(1); dd(i+1,i) = a(1) imin(i) = i-1; imax(i) = i+1 @@ -91,7 +92,7 @@ subroutine set_coeff_up_2_1 ( nsize, dir, loc_order, bb, gsize, imin, imax, dd ) dd = zero imin = 0 - imax = 0 + imax = -1 if ( bb(1) == 0 ) then il = 1 + gsize |